De Bruyne: 'Sterling will only improve'

Kevin De Bruyne has warned the Premier League that Raheem Sterling will only improve after scoring three times in Manchester City's 5-1 win over Bournemouth.

The Citizens' £49m man lit up the Etihad with a hat-trick in Saturday's rout, with De Bruyne - who fetched a club-record £54m - assisting Sterling's second.

"He's really good, he's only 20 years old so there's a lot more to come," he told reporters. "But he made the goals look easy today and that will only help his confidence.

"He likes to run deep and that makes it easier to find him, I'll try to play that ball.

"Sometimes it will work well, like today, and other times maybe he will not arrive. But if he makes runs like that it's good for me. If a player has pace like that it's always an advantage."

Manuel Pellegrini's side remain top of the Premier League, two points clear of Arsenal and Manchester United.
